Like many here I am a Wu fan since the beginning, not a latecomer at all, so I do feel a bit cheated that I won't get to hear the music (What could've been) but more so that the world won't, because this is exactly what has let the Wu legacy down in recent years is their production/ soundscape, RZA to be precise. Most people including myself thought this project could've been the one to at least repair some of that, giving the true fans and new fans a dose of what made Wu the force they were in the first place but it hasn't, it won't because it can't! Being that the whole thing is about appreciating the music, respecting the art etc is ironic seeing no one can respect or appreciate something they can't hear making it not about the music at all, rather making a political statement.
The 1 piece of hope before it all truly disappears (For myself anyway) comes from the article I saw on sohh.com a couple months back by 4th Disciple saying...
“The Clan doesn’t make that music,” that’s what I hear a lot. People say, “They don’t make it like ‘this’ anymore. They don’t make it like ‘that’ anymore. We want to hear ‘this,’ we want to hear 4th Disciple with the Clan.” They want to hear those combinations that made Wu-Tang what it was. That’s what I’m striving to bring back, I want to give people what they want."
That last line is what makes his statement honorable, it should always be about the people!
